Many thanks for the offer. I am trying to understand what is available from the onboard EFI ROM for this add-in PCIe card, whether there are options for different ROM images (PXE, iSCSI, …?) and if there are mechanisms to check which version of the ROM is installed.

 

I have tried ipxe.efi (from http://ipxe.org/download) but that doesn't appear to recognise the AX200. It may be that iPXE needs its own internal driver for the AX200.

 

If an AX200 was deployed in a tablet or similar device without onboard Ethernet I assume that it might offer an option for PXE booting via wireless (PXE is offered as boot options from the EFI "BIOS" on my server with two X722 Ethernet adapters). If so, I am curious to know what would provide the PXE functionality: the EFI "BIOS"; the onboard EFI ROM; an EFI driver; or some combination?

 

My apologies if this is a bit vague. I am still learning about EFI.
